C=
Center of curvature: the center of the sphere whose surface has been used to make the mirror
PA=
Principle of Axis: line through the center of curvature and mirror. It intersects the mirror at 90 degrees and is normal to the surface
V=
Vertex: the point where the principle axis intersects the mirror
F=
Focal point: the point light rays parallel to the principal axis converge when reflected off a concave mirror
